Why is My Laptop Screen Suddenly Blue? Understanding and Troubleshooting the Blue Screen of Death (BSOD)

The dreaded blue screen. We’ve all heard about it, and many of us have unfortunately experienced it. Seeing your laptop screen suddenly turn blue can be alarming, especially if you’re in the middle of something important. This isn’t just a display issue; it’s a sign that your computer has encountered a critical error and has shut down to prevent further damage. This article will delve into the causes of the blue screen of death (BSOD), how to troubleshoot it, and what preventative measures you can take to minimize its occurrence.

Understanding the Blue Screen of Death (BSOD)

The Blue Screen of Death, technically known as a Stop Error, is a safety mechanism built into Windows operating systems. When Windows encounters a critical error that it cannot recover from, it displays a blue screen with a message indicating the nature of the problem. This screen often contains technical information, including error codes, that can help diagnose the root cause. Think of it as your laptop’s emergency stop button, preventing further data corruption or hardware damage.

The specific appearance of the BSOD has changed across different versions of Windows. Older versions displayed a more cryptic and technical message, while newer versions, like Windows 10 and 11, offer a more user-friendly interface with a simplified explanation and even a QR code to scan for more information. Regardless of the appearance, the underlying principle remains the same: a serious error has forced the system to halt.

Common Causes of the Blue Screen of Death

There are numerous reasons why your laptop might display a blue screen. These causes can be broadly categorized into hardware issues, software conflicts, driver problems, and overheating. Understanding these categories is the first step in diagnosing and resolving the problem.

Hardware Issues

Faulty hardware is a significant contributor to BSOD errors. This can include problems with your RAM (Random Access Memory), hard drive or SSD, graphics card, or even the motherboard. Hardware failures often manifest intermittently at first, becoming more frequent as the problem worsens.

RAM problems are common culprits. If your RAM modules are failing, they can cause data corruption, leading to system instability and BSOD errors. Similarly, a failing hard drive or SSD can also trigger BSODs due to the system’s inability to reliably read or write data.

Over time, components can degrade due to heat and wear. Dust accumulation can exacerbate these issues by reducing cooling efficiency and leading to overheating.

Software Conflicts

While hardware failures are a major cause, software conflicts can also lead to BSOD errors. This typically involves conflicts between different applications or between an application and the operating system itself.

Incompatible software or poorly written applications can attempt to access system resources in a way that destabilizes the operating system, resulting in a BSOD. Sometimes, newly installed software can conflict with existing software, especially if both programs attempt to use the same system resources or drivers.

Operating system corruption can also cause blue screens. This can be due to incomplete updates, malware infections, or accidental deletion of critical system files.

Driver Problems

Drivers are essential software components that allow your operating system to communicate with hardware devices. Outdated, corrupted, or incompatible drivers are a frequent cause of BSOD errors.

When a driver is faulty, it can cause errors in the way the system interacts with the corresponding hardware, leading to system instability and a BSOD. This is especially common after upgrading your operating system or installing new hardware.

Incompatible drivers may also arise from installing incorrect versions, installing drivers meant for different operating systems, or conflicts between multiple drivers that are fighting to access the same hardware.

Overheating

Excessive heat can cause various computer problems, including BSOD errors. When your laptop’s components overheat, they can become unstable and malfunction, leading to system crashes.

Overheating can be caused by several factors, including blocked vents, a failing cooling fan, or a build-up of dust inside the laptop. Laptops are particularly susceptible to overheating because of their compact design, which limits airflow and makes it harder to dissipate heat effectively.

Running resource-intensive applications, such as games or video editing software, can also generate significant heat. If your laptop’s cooling system isn’t adequate to handle the thermal load, it can quickly overheat and trigger a BSOD.

Troubleshooting the Blue Screen of Death

Troubleshooting a BSOD can seem daunting, but with a systematic approach, you can often identify and resolve the underlying problem. Start by noting the error message and any associated error codes displayed on the blue screen. This information can provide valuable clues about the cause of the error.

Analyzing the Error Message

The error message displayed on the blue screen often provides insights into the type of problem that occurred. Some common error messages include “PAGE_FAULT_IN_NONPAGED_AREA,” “IRQL_NOT_LESS_OR_EQUAL,” and “DRIVER_IRQL_NOT_LESS_OR_EQUAL.”

  • PAGE_FAULT_IN_NONPAGED_AREA: This error often indicates a problem with RAM or drivers.
  • IRQL_NOT_LESS_OR_EQUAL: This error usually points to driver issues or hardware incompatibility.
  • DRIVER_IRQL_NOT_LESS_OR_EQUAL: This error specifically indicates a problem with a driver attempting to access memory it doesn’t have permission to.

Search the internet for the specific error message and any accompanying error codes. You’ll likely find numerous forum posts, articles, and videos that discuss the error and offer potential solutions.

Checking Recent Changes

Consider any recent changes you’ve made to your laptop. Did you recently install new software, update drivers, or add new hardware? If so, these changes might be the source of the problem.

Try uninstalling any recently installed software to see if that resolves the BSOD. If you suspect a driver issue, try rolling back to a previous version of the driver or uninstalling the driver altogether.

If you recently added new hardware, make sure it’s compatible with your laptop and that the drivers are properly installed. Try removing the new hardware to see if that stops the BSOD errors.

Running Hardware Diagnostics

If you suspect a hardware problem, run hardware diagnostics to test the functionality of your laptop’s components. Windows includes built-in memory diagnostic tools that can check for RAM errors.

Many laptop manufacturers also provide their own diagnostic tools that can test various hardware components, including the hard drive, SSD, and graphics card. Consult your laptop’s documentation or the manufacturer’s website for instructions on how to run these diagnostics.

If the diagnostic tools detect any errors, it may indicate a hardware failure that needs to be addressed. Replacing the faulty hardware component may be necessary.

Updating Drivers and BIOS

Outdated or corrupted drivers are a common cause of BSOD errors. Make sure you have the latest drivers installed for all of your hardware components, especially the graphics card, network adapter, and chipset.

You can download the latest drivers from the manufacturer’s website. Be sure to download the drivers that are specifically designed for your operating system and hardware.

Updating the BIOS (Basic Input/Output System) can also sometimes resolve compatibility issues and improve system stability. However, updating the BIOS is a more advanced procedure, and it’s important to follow the manufacturer’s instructions carefully to avoid damaging your laptop.

Checking for Overheating

If your laptop is overheating, it can cause various problems, including BSOD errors. Make sure your laptop’s vents are clear of dust and debris, and that the cooling fan is functioning properly.

Use a can of compressed air to clean out the vents and remove any dust that may be blocking airflow. If the cooling fan is not working, you may need to replace it.

Consider using a laptop cooling pad to improve airflow and keep your laptop cool, especially when running resource-intensive applications.

Performing a System Restore or Reset

If you’re unable to identify the cause of the BSOD, you can try performing a system restore or a system reset. A system restore will revert your laptop to a previous point in time when it was working properly. This can undo any recent changes that may be causing the problem.

A system reset will reinstall Windows and erase all of your personal files and settings. This is a more drastic measure, but it can often resolve software-related issues that are causing the BSOD. Back up your important files before performing a system reset, as all data will be erased.

Preventative Measures to Minimize BSOD Occurrences

While BSOD errors can be frustrating, there are several steps you can take to minimize their occurrence and keep your laptop running smoothly.

  • Keep your operating system and drivers up to date. Regularly install updates for Windows and your drivers to ensure that you have the latest bug fixes and security patches.
  • Install software from trusted sources only. Avoid downloading software from untrusted websites, as it may contain malware or other malicious code that can destabilize your system.
  • Run regular malware scans. Use a reputable antivirus program to scan your laptop for malware and remove any threats that are detected.
  • Keep your laptop clean and well-ventilated. Regularly clean your laptop’s vents to prevent overheating. Use a laptop cooling pad if necessary.
  • Monitor your system’s performance. Use Task Manager to monitor your CPU, memory, and disk usage. If you notice any unusual activity, investigate further to identify the cause.
  • Back up your important files regularly. In case of a system failure, having a recent backup will allow you to restore your data and get back up and running quickly.

By following these preventative measures, you can significantly reduce the risk of encountering the Blue Screen of Death and keep your laptop running reliably.

While this guide provides a comprehensive overview of the Blue Screen of Death, remember that diagnosing and resolving the issue can sometimes be complex. If you’re unable to resolve the problem on your own, consider seeking assistance from a qualified computer technician.

What exactly is a Blue Screen of Death (BSOD), and why does it happen?

The Blue Screen of Death (BSOD), often referred to as a stop error or blue screen error, is an error screen displayed on Windows computers after a fatal system error. It indicates that Windows has encountered a critical issue from which it cannot recover, forcing it to shut down abruptly to prevent further damage to your hardware or data. This abrupt shutdown is accompanied by a blue screen filled with technical information about the error.

The reasons for a BSOD are varied but generally stem from issues related to hardware, software, or drivers. Faulty or incompatible hardware components, corrupted system files, outdated or improperly installed drivers, and conflicts between software programs are common culprits. Overclocking your system beyond its stable limits can also trigger BSODs, as can malware infections that corrupt critical system processes. Identifying the specific cause requires analyzing the error codes displayed on the blue screen itself.

How do I read the information presented on the Blue Screen of Death?

The BSOD displays crucial information that can help diagnose the underlying problem. Look for the “Stop Code” or “Error Code,” which is typically formatted as “0x000000XX” (where XX represents a hexadecimal number). This code is the most important piece of information, as it often points to the specific type of error that occurred. The BSOD may also display the name of the file that caused the error, which is often a driver file (.sys) or a system file. This information provides valuable clues about the problem area.

Additionally, the BSOD often includes a brief descriptive message explaining the nature of the error. While these messages can be generic, they sometimes offer hints about the potential cause. It’s essential to note down the Stop Code, the filename (if present), and the descriptive message. You can then use these details to research the error online, consult Microsoft’s knowledge base, or seek help from technical support forums. Remember to take a picture or write down the information quickly, as the screen usually disappears after a short period.

What are some common causes of a BSOD?

Hardware issues are a frequent source of BSOD errors. These can range from faulty RAM modules to failing hard drives or graphics cards. Overheating of components, especially the CPU or GPU, can also lead to system instability and trigger a BSOD. Incompatible or improperly installed hardware devices can conflict with the operating system, resulting in critical errors.

Software and driver problems are another major contributor. Corrupted or outdated device drivers, especially those for graphics cards, network adapters, or storage controllers, are a common cause. Incompatible software applications, particularly those that interact directly with the system kernel, can also trigger BSODs. Furthermore, malware or virus infections can damage critical system files, leading to system instability and BSOD errors.

How can I troubleshoot a BSOD if it only happened once?

If you’ve only experienced a single BSOD, it might be a transient error that doesn’t necessarily indicate a serious problem. Start by checking for any recent software or driver updates you may have installed. Roll back any recent updates if you suspect they might be the cause. Run a thorough virus scan using reputable antivirus software to rule out malware infections. Also, check your system logs for any error messages or warnings that occurred around the time of the BSOD.

Monitor your system for any recurring issues. If the BSOD doesn’t reappear, it might have been a one-off event caused by a temporary glitch. However, if the BSOD occurs repeatedly, even after taking the initial troubleshooting steps, you’ll need to investigate further. Consider performing memory diagnostics, checking your hard drive for errors, and ensuring your hardware is properly seated and cooled.

How can I prevent BSOD errors from happening in the future?

Proactive maintenance is key to preventing BSOD errors. Regularly update your operating system and device drivers to ensure compatibility and stability. Install updates promptly as they often include critical bug fixes and security patches. Make sure you’re only using compatible and reliable hardware. Also, use reputable antivirus software and keep it updated to protect against malware infections.

Practice safe computing habits. Avoid downloading software from untrusted sources and be cautious when opening email attachments or clicking on suspicious links. Regularly back up your important data to protect against data loss in case of system failures. Additionally, monitor your system’s temperature and ensure adequate cooling to prevent overheating, which can lead to hardware failures and BSOD errors.

When should I consider reinstalling Windows to fix BSOD issues?

Reinstalling Windows should be considered as a last resort after exhausting other troubleshooting methods. If you’ve tried updating drivers, running hardware diagnostics, and troubleshooting software conflicts without success, a clean install of Windows might be necessary. This process erases your current operating system and replaces it with a fresh copy, potentially resolving underlying issues that are causing the BSOD errors.

Before reinstalling Windows, be sure to back up all your important data, as the process will erase everything on your system drive. Obtain the necessary installation media or create a bootable USB drive with the Windows installation files. You’ll also need your product key to activate Windows after the installation. Keep in mind that a clean install will require you to reinstall all your applications and drivers, so ensure you have access to the necessary installation files and driver packages before proceeding.

How do I test my RAM to see if it’s causing the BSOD?

Testing your RAM is a crucial step in diagnosing BSOD errors, as faulty RAM can often lead to system instability. Windows includes a built-in memory diagnostic tool that can help identify memory-related issues. You can access this tool by searching for “Windows Memory Diagnostic” in the Start menu and running it. The tool will prompt you to restart your computer and perform a memory test during the boot process.

The memory diagnostic tool will run a series of tests to check for errors in your RAM modules. If any errors are detected, it indicates that one or more of your RAM modules might be faulty and need to be replaced. It’s also a good idea to try running the test with only one RAM module installed at a time to isolate which module is causing the issue. Additionally, consider using third-party memory testing tools like Memtest86 for more comprehensive and thorough testing.

Leave a Comment